National Theatre Live: A Midsummer Night's Dream is a live recording of a theatrical production based on the play by William Shakespeare. The play is directed by Nicholas Hytner and stars Gwendoline Christie, Olivia Ross, David Moorst, Hammed Animashaun, and more.

The story is set in an enchanted forest outside Athens where a fairy kingdom, ruled by Oberon and Titania, is in turmoil. The two are fighting over a young Indian prince whom Titania has taken under her protection. As they continue to bicker, Oberon decides to take revenge on Titania and plans to make her fall in love with a mortal.

Meanwhile, four lovers - Hermia, Lysander, Demetrius, and Helena - run away to the woods to escape the law of Athens, which forbids Hermia from marrying Lysander. In the midst of the chaos, the mischievous fairy Puck is sent on a mission by Oberon to enchant the wrong lovers, causing them to fall in love with the wrong people and triggering hilarious and dramatic consequences.

The play also features a group of amateur actors, or mechanicals, who are rehearsing a play to perform at the wedding of Theseus and Hippolyta. Their comical antics add to the chaos and confusion in the forest.

Overall, National Theatre Live: A Midsummer Night's Dream is a whimsical and magical tale of love, desire, and mischief.
